We walked accross the street and looked at the guys cutting ice out of the river for the ice sculptures they are making for the snow and ice festival.  It is really something.  I wish the sculptures were already done so we could see them.  We were only out for about 5 or 7 minutes and had to come back because we were freezing.
The entire river is frozen over.  There is a row of horse drawn carriages waiting to give people rides accross the frozen river.  I don't think so.  But it is neat to see.
We ventured over to Walmart.  That was interesting.  Walmart begins on floor 2 of the building and goes up several levels.  It is very crowded, and took us a while to find everything we needed.  At the checkout, we realized we were supposed to have our own bags.  Oops.  It took us quite a while to convince the cashier to sell us a reusable bag to put some of the stuff in.  The rest we just had to carry.  Our total bill was only around $20 and we got a lot of stuff.  I took a photo of it all.  Leedy wanted all of the food in the store, well all of the candy.  We let her pick out a few things, but said no to some and she seemed to be okay, only stomping her foot once.
